The Chicago White Sox compete in the AL Central division and play home games at Guaranteed Rate Field in Chicago. The franchise is a franchise in the middle of a multi-year rebuild, with a home park that has historically favored power-first right-handed hitters. For prop bettors, that context matters: every batter-pitcher matchup is a function of the player, the opponent, and the venue — and Guaranteed Rate Field is a strong-hitter park boosting offense significantly over league average.
From a prop-betting standpoint, Chicago White Sox home games offer Guaranteed Rate Field plays as a moderate HR park, but the prevailing wind off Lake Michigan adds variance — particularly affecting day-game HR props. Lines move differently here than at typical neutral parks, so the same player matchup can produce a very different expected outcome depending on whether Chicago White Sox are hosting or traveling.
